Major General P K Chakravorty, VSM (Retd) is a retired military officer with extensive experience, serving as Deputy Director General in Perspective Planning Directorate, Defence Attaché to Vietnam, and Additional Director General Artillery at Army Headquarters. He has post-retirement advisory roles with BrahMos Aerospace and is a prolific author, contributing to top think tanks. Gen Chakravorty specializes in geo-strategy, firepower, and defense procurement, actively engaging in national and international seminars on these topics.
